Cleaning & Caring for Your Gold Nuggets and Bullion
Maintaining the shine of your gold pieces doesn't demand a complicated process . While gold is generally impervious to tarnishing , accumulated dirt and oils can reduce its appearance. To polish your gold, you can gently use a soft cloth dampened with lukewarm solution and a little amount of detergent. Avoid abrasive products or pads as they can harm the surface . Rinse thoroughly and pat dry with a new cloth . For nuggets with intricate patterns , a mild toothbrush can help in dislodging debris . Remember, professional cleaning by a refiner is always an option for more comprehensive maintenance if you want it.
